AC Unit Water Removal Cost in Del Valle, TX
The cost of AC unit water removal services can vary depending on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our estimates are based on real-world costs. Here’s a breakdown of typical price ranges for our services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Dehumidification and drying | $300 – $1,500 | Size of affected area, type of equipment used |
| Cleaning and sanitizing | $200 – $1,000 | Type of equipment used, level of contamination |
| Final inspection and testing | $150 – $500 | Type of equipment used, level of testing required |
Keep in mind that these estimates are based on average costs and may vary depending on your specific situation. Our team will provide a detailed estimate after assessing the damage.

Common Questions About AC Unit Water Removal
Will my insurance cover the cost of AC unit water removal?
Yes, most insurance policies cover water damage and AC unit repairs. But, the specifics depend on your policy and provider. Our team can help you navigate the claims process.
How long will the AC unit water removal process take?
The duration of the process depends on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. Our team will provide a detailed timeline after assessing the damage.
Will you need to replace my AC unit if it’s been damaged by water?
Not necessarily. While water damage can compromise the integrity of your AC unit, our team can often repair or replace individual parts. We’ll assess the damage and recommend the best course of action to save you money and prevent further damage.
How can I prevent AC unit water damage in the future?
Regular maintenance is key to preventing water damage. Our team recommends regular inspections, filter cleaning, and low-pressure washing to keep your AC unit running smoothly.
